How they compare

Bolivia (Plurinational State of) currently reports 9.9% against 9.7% in United States of America, a difference of 0.2%.

Across all 25 years both countries report, Bolivia (Plurinational State of) has been ahead every year.

Bolivia (Plurinational State of) ranks 41st and United States of America ranks 44th of 178 countries.

Bolivia (Plurinational State of) has averaged higher in every one of the 3 decades both report.

Head to head by decade

Decade Bolivia (Plurinational State of) United States of America Difference Ahead
2000s 9.0% 7.9% 1.1% Bolivia (Plurinational State of)
2010s 8.9% 8.4% 0.5% Bolivia (Plurinational State of)
2020s 9.4% 9.3% 0.2% Bolivia (Plurinational State of)

Averages of every year both report within each decade.
